132 Pridgen grafted on fig leaf gourd rootstock. I've been busy with work since the holidays and have been slack updating my progress on my first attempt at hole insertion grafting. Photo is of graft 3 days removed from healing chamber. Note the lack of green in plant. I'm assuming it was because it had been in the dark for about 6 days.

Plant is around 17 days after healing chamber. I can't believe the growth rate of this plant. I normally feed my plants a diluted fish/seaweed mixture when starting. Not this one. Plant is showing 12 stems from the stump. Cannot determine which would be the main or which would be considered finger vines. If it puts as much into the fruit as it does the vine growth,the possibilities are endless. I'm assuming pruning and deadheading would be a full time job with this.

Day....... I don't know.Have to go back and do the math. 132 Pridgen grafted to a fig leaf gourd rootstock. Plant has three vines now.My 3 yr old son deadheaded the main for me at approx. 14 inches. One finger at approx.24 inches.A third approx. 6 inches growing on back side of plant. Plan was to practice grafting this winter, and now I just want to see it flower. Plant has contracted something (downy mildew ?) I think it has been caused by the grow light. The plant has appeared to sweat at times. It's a small light,and there is a lot of plant packed under there.
 
Monday, February 15 View Page
Note the yellowing of the leaf and brown spots. Started on one leaf and now has spread through plant.
